Amgen Inc. Research Report
On July 9, 2013, Amgen Inc. (Amgen) announced its new collaboration agreement with Servier, leveraging both the Companies' commitment to treat cardiovascular disease. Amgen reported that it has obtained commercial rights in the U.S. to Servier's novel oral drug, approved in the EU as Procoralan (ivabradine), for chronic heart failure and stable angina in patients with elevated heart rates, as well as an exclusive option to develop and commercialize Servier's investigational molecule, S38844, for cardiovascular diseases in the U.S. The Company stated that S38844 is in Phase 2 studies for the treatment of heart failure. Sean E. Harper, M.D., Executive Vice President of Research and Development at Amgen, said, "A critical unmet medical need remains for patients who don't respond adequately to current available therapies for heart failure and angina. Ivabradine, an If inhibitor, offers a novel alternative approach for patients with elevated heart rates. We value Servier's extensive experience in cardiovascular disease and look forward to working with them as Amgen continues to build our presence in this area." Celldex Therapeutics, Inc. Research Report
On July 10, 2013, Celldex Therapeutics, Inc. (Celldex) announced that the US Patent and Trademark Office (USPTO) has issued US Patent No: 8,481,029, 'Human immune therapies using a CD27 agonist alone or in combination with other immune modulators,' which broadly supports the Company's product candidate CDX-1127, a fully human monoclonal antibody (mAb) that targets CD27 and is currently in Phase 1 clinical development for the treatment of solid tumors and hematologic malignancies. Celldex reported that the patent has been assigned to the University of Southampton and that the Company has an exclusive license to the patent based on the execution of an exclusive licensing agreement with the University of Southampton to develop human antibodies to CD27 in November 2008. Tibor Keler, Senior Vice President and Chief Scientific Officer of Celldex, stated, "We continue to make excellent progress advancing CDX-1127 and securing this key piece of intellectual property is an important achievement as we expand our clinical program in solid tumors and complete dose-escalation studies in hematologic malignancies." Vivus Inc. Research Report
On July 9, 2013, Vivus Inc. (Vivus) announced that it has entered into a License and Commercialization Agreement and a Supply Agreement with Menarini and its wholly-owned subsidiary BERLIN-CHEMIE AG/MENARINI. The partnership aims to commercialize and promote SPEDRA (avanafil) in over 40 European countries, as well as Australia and New Zealand. Timothy E. Morris, Senior Vice President of Global Corporate Development and Finance and Chief Financial Officer of VIVUS, commented, "Menarini has tremendous know how and marketing capabilities throughout Europe and has already established a presence in men's health with the acquisition last year of Priligy (Dapoxetine) for treatment of premature ejaculation (PE). The licensing process was competitive and Menarini was chosen for their extensive presence in their territories and their history of successful drug launches across Europe. We look forward to a long and productive collaboration with Menarini." The Medicines Company Research Report
On July 2, 2013, The Medicines Company announced that it has achieved positive results for its Phase 3 SOLO II clinical trial of oritavancin for the treatment of acute bacterial skin and skin structure infections (ABSSSI) caused by susceptible gram-positive bacteria. Clive Meanwell MD PhD, Chairman and CEO of The Medicines Company, said, "SOLO trial data consistently show that a single dose of oritavancin given on presentation of a patient with ABSSSI to hospital can cure gram positive infections, including MRSA infections, and be at least as efficacious as multiple days of twice-daily vancomycin infusions. The safety profile also appears potentially advantageous over vancomycin. We anticipate submitting an application for oritavancin US market clearance in the fourth quarter of 2013 and a European filing in 2014." Raptor Pharmaceuticals Corp. Research Report
On June 28, 2013, Raptor Pharmaceuticals Corp. (Raptor Pharmaceutical) announced that it has received a positive opinion from the European Committee for Medicinal Products for Human Use (CHMP), recommending marketing authorization for PROCYSBI 25mg and 75mg gastro-resistant hard capsules, cysteamine (as mercaptamine bitartrate) for the treatment of proven nephropathic cystinosis. The Company said that if approved, PROCYSBI will be indicated for the treatment of proven nephropathic cystinosis. Christopher M. Starr, Ph.D., CEO of Raptor Pharmaceuticals, stated, "The positive opinion of the CHMP brings us an important step closer to anticipated EU approval of PROCYSBI subject to the European Commission review process."
